“gold-digger” is a crass tag nobody wants, but after choosing 1,000 solitary guys, I realized its becoming used on women more often than they feel (and often unfairly). David, get older 37 from longer isle, NY, explained their previous date this way:  “She needed a ‘Perfect 10:’ the guy that’s a 5 from the appearances level with $5 million inside the bank.”

As a matchmaking mentor and matchmaker, i have spent the past ten years conducting some non-traditional online dating investigation making use of an “exit interview” method I discovered at Harvard company School and applied to the dating globe. We interviewed 1,000 males to discover exactly what really happened after a dating disconnect. A lot of men defined ladies who they stereotyped as very contemplating cash or overly dedicated to obtaining or keeping a lavish way of living. Put another way, they perceived some women as “Park Avenue Princesses.” In face, The Park Avenue Princess was actually the no. 4 common cause men lost fascination with a female after seeing the woman online dating sites profile, trading e-mails, or going on a primary or 2nd big date.

Men have their radar up for silver diggers who they feel would like to marry a life style with their man. Within unstable economic climate, economic protection is far more fickle now than ever. Guys are increasingly sensitive and painful about discovering some one real that will stick to all of them “for richer or poorer.” They often times avoided a female if she penned in her own on the internet account one thing along these contours: “I love buying” or “I adore great wines and champagne.” In a short email change, guys cringed if a woman wrote “I’m looking for men who’s reasonable” or “a person who’s attained profession success.” Guys thought we were holding proxy statements for “i wish to be studied care of economically.” Definitely, they were frequently misperceptions, however in the early stages of online dating, perception is truth.

Men – both rich and bad– know cash is an issue throughout the internet dating circuit. But like a negative nation american song, they simply want to be enjoyed for who they are. They don’t really wish to be cheated economically or ask yourself if her thoughts are genuine. Know me as naïve or a hopeless intimate, but i am betting that a lot of among these expected Park Avenue Princesses aren’t truly testing their particular men for the money. In my opinion in a lot of of these instances guys reported, women were just creating informal dialogue and sincerely looking to get to understand their own date much better. However if a woman happened upon some wrong concerns accidentally, the gold-digger label had been slapped on the fast by defective, knee-jerk assumptions which a guy generated after seeing unnecessary poor reality television shows. Now you understand what’s occurring, you can simply abstain from these kinds of questions so that you’re perhaps not incorrectly accused.
